some news:

He may have once been loyal to the Los Angeles Bloods, but Game is riding with a gang of New Yorkers on his new album.

The Compton-bred MC has completed a song with East Coast rappers Jadakiss and Jim Jones for his fourth effort The R.E.D. Album, currently slated for a February release. The track was produced by Get Busy Committee frontman Scoop Deville, who helmed Snoop Dogg’s “I Wanna Rock” and “Life of da Party.”

“[I'm] working in the lab with Game,” the West Coast producer told Rap-Up.com. “We did a record called ‘Gangs in New York’ with Jim Jones and Jadakiss.”

It is unknown if “Gangs” will make R.E.D.’s final tracklisting since Game has recorded a plethora of material, including collaborations with Justin Timberlake, Chris Brown, Dr. Dre, Pharrell, Nicki Minaj, and Gucci Mane.
